Please note that the European Commission published updated procedural and classification guidance regarding variations on 16 May 2013.

The updates become effective on 4 August 2103 and reflect changes to Commission Regulation 1234/2008 (external link) introduced by Commission Regulation 712/2012 (external link), including the application of the procedures to variations to purely national marketing authorisations. The classification guideline has been updated to reflect adaptation to technical progress, changes introduced in the basic legislation, and the experience acquired to date and will replace the current guidance. Consequently, the updated classification guideline should be used for any variation submitted on or after 4 August. It is therefore important that any individuals involved in the preparation of variation submissions familiarise themselves with the updated guidance and take it into immediate consideration for any new proposed grouping requests for variations that are likely to be submitted after it becomes effective.
Further detailed guidance will be issued in due course as part of a general update to the Variations specific website pages.
